About the job Job Title : Principal Fire Officer Location : Manchester Salary : £, - £, per annum depending on experience Job type : Full Time, Permanent (1 FTE) Closing date : / / 5 The Role : We are looking to recruit a Principal Fire Officer with significant experience of fire safety management to join our Client Services team, who are committed to supporting the University's core aims of excellence in Research, Teaching, and Social Responsibility. The University of Manchester is a top‑ranking research‑intensive university with the largest and one of the most internationally diverse campuses in the UK. Your role will be important in ensuring high standards of fire safety are maintained for the University's staff, students and visitors across our extensive building portfolio. Reporting to the Head of Client Services, you will be responsible for advising the University on fire safety strategy and management. As well as providing competent technical advice, this will include developing fire safety standards, monitoring and auditing our fire safety systems and ensuring we maintain auditable records of our fire safety arrangements, including up to date records of fire risk assessments, fire strategies and fire evacuation plans. You will work closely with Professional Services colleagues, and the professional and academic departments of the University, to ensure a co‑ordinated approach to the management of fire safety risk, the achievement of a positive culture and high standards of fire safety performance. Your competency in fire safety management will be evident through your extensive experience and qualifications, which will include experience of advising on fire safety for complex buildings and high‑rise accommodation. The successful candidate will hold a membership with a relevant professional organisation, along with having a recognised fire risk assessment competency. You will possess excellent oral and written communication skills and a pragmatic approach, demonstrating a practical application which takes account of business needs. A consultative and facilitative style of service delivery, combined with good influencing and motivating skills and the ability to plan and manage projects and workloads to deliver necessary changes will be essential to deliver the requirements of this role. The successful candidate will possess Membership of the Institute of Fire Engineers (MIFireE) and be educated to degree level in a Fire / Engineering / Construction related discipline or IFE Level 4 Certificate, with experience of managing a team of staff. Relevant experience in the provision of fire advice on construction, development and maintenance work is essential.
